Southern African osmiine bees: taxonomic notes, two new species, a key to Wainia, and biological observations (Hymenoptera: Anthophila: Megachilidae)

Abstract

Resulting from the examination of the type specimens of the southern African bee species originally described in the genus Osmia, the taxonomic placement of 19 species is formally established. The following combinations are formalised: Osmia atrorufa Friese, 1913 to Wainia (Caposmia) atrorufa (Friese) comb. nov.; Osmia ausica Cockerell, 1944 to Hoplitis (Anthocopa) ausica (Cockerell) comb. nov.; Osmia capicola Friese, 1909 (replacement name for Osmia capensis Cameron, 1906) to Capicola capicola (Friese) comb. nov.; Osmia flavipes Friese, 1909 to Afranthidium (Nigranthidium) flavipes (Friese) comb. nov.; Osmia forficulina Cockerell, 1921 to Hoplitis (Anthocopa) forficulina (Cockerell) comb. nov.; Osmia karooensis Brauns, 1926 to Hoplitis (Anthocopa) karooensis (Brauns) comb. nov.; Osmia mediorufa Cockerell, 1932 to Hoplitis (Anthocopa) mediorufa (Cockerell) comb. nov.; Osmia namaquaensis Friese, 1913 to Hoplitis (Anthocopa) namaquaensis (Friese) comb. nov.; Osmia natalensis Cockerell, 1920 to Wainia (Caposmia) natalensis (Cockerell) comb. nov.; Osmia neavei Cockerell, 1936 to Hoplitis (Anthoc- opa) neavei (Cockerell) comb. nov.; Osmia ogilviae Cockerell, 1932 to Hoplitis (Anthocopa) ogilviae (Cockerell) comb. nov.; Osmia ornatula Cockerell, 1932 to Hoplitis (Anthocopa) ornatula (Cockerell) comb. nov.; Osmia orthodonta Cokkerell, 1932 to Hoplitis (Anthocopa) orthodonta (Cockerell) comb. nov.; Osmia pachyceps Friese, 1922 to Othinosmia (Megaloheriades) pachyceps (Friese) comb. nov.; Osmia piliventris Friese, 1913 to Hoplitis (Anthocopa) piliventris (Friese) comb. nov.; Osmia reginae Cockerell, 1932 to Hoplitis (Anthocopa) reginae (Cockerell) comb. nov.; Osmia rhodognatha Cockerell, 1932 to Hoplitis (Anthocopa) rhodognatha (Cockerell) comb. nov.; Osmia similis Friese, 1909 to Hoplitis (Anthocopa) similis (Friese) comb. nov.; Osmia turneri Cockerell, 1937 to Hoplitis (Anthocopa) turneri (Cockerell) comb. nov. The following new synonyms are established: Hoplitis (Anthocopa) namaquaensis (Friese) = Osmia ausica Cockerell syn. nov.; Capicola capicola (Friese) (replacement name for Osmia capensis Cameron) = Capicola braunsiana Friese, 1911 syn. nov., Capicola aurescens Cockerell, 1932 syn. nov., Hesperapis turneri Cockerell, 1934 syn. nov., Hesperapis obscura Cockerell, 1934 syn. nov.; Unlike the statement in Michener (2000: 403) Osmia? capensis Cameron, 1905 is probably not a synonym of Capicola braunsiana Friese given its body length. The type seems to be lost and the identity of this species remains unclear. Hoplitis (Anthocopa) similis (Friese) = Osmia forficulina Cockerell syn. nov; Wainia (Wainiella) sakaniensis (Cockerell, 1936) = Heriades albobarbatus Cockerell, 1937 syn. nov., Heriades debilicornis Cockerell, 1940 syn. nov., Heriades perpolitus Cockerell, 1947 syn. nov., Heriades otaviensis Cockerell, 1947 syn. nov. The status of Wainia (Caposmia) elizabethae (Friese, 1909) spec. rev. as a valid species is restored. Hoplitis (Anthocopa) conchophila Kuhlmann spec. nov., Wainia (Caposmia) gessorum Kuhlmann spec. nov. and the male of Wainia (Caposmia) atrorufa (Friese) are described for the first time. A checklist and an illustrated key to the seven southern African species of Wainia is provided. Notes on known flower visiting and nesting of Hoplitis (Anthocopa) and Wainia are given under the relevant species.
